I have a 96 prelude which is obdII and i swapped in a obdI jdm H22A i need to know how to wire up the distributor? color codes would be nice. my old motor had the crank angle sensor at the crank and is also external coil while the H22 distributor is internal and has the sensor in the distributor.

well i found a solution, i got an obdI engine harness and then bought a obdI distributor, that had the crank sensor and it worked , i actually have another obdI harness lying around
 
still not sure how it would have fixed the problem tho.... did u use the jdm ecu or stock ecu. OH also did u get the OBDII to OBDI conversion harness to use the jdm ecu. thx
 
the problem with the obdII harness is that the crank sensor wires are at the crank , when u swap to obdI harness the crank sensor wires are at the distributor , so with the obdI distributor that has the crank sensor at the distributor ur all set. yea i'm running jdm ecu and i used the obdII to obdI conversion harness.
